Skip to content

LG 11763 Include new device in MFA analytics#9784

Merged
kevinsmaster5 merged 21 commits intomainfrom
kmas-lg-11763-new-device-mfa-analytics
Jan 5, 2024
Merged

LG 11763 Include new device in MFA analytics#9784
kevinsmaster5 merged 21 commits intomainfrom
kmas-lg-11763-new-device-mfa-analytics

Conversation

@kevinsmaster5
Copy link
Contributor

@kevinsmaster5 kevinsmaster5 commented Dec 18, 2023

🎫 Ticket

LG-11763

🛠 Summary of changes

Adds property to Multi-Factor Authentication event declaring whether or not a new device is in use.

📜 Testing Plan

  • In a local environment terminal run make_analytics
  • Clear all of your localhost cookies from your browser
  • Log in and authenticate at http://localhost:300
  • Receive new sign in notification
  • Terminal should show a Multi-Factor Authentication event with the property "new_device" : true
  • Log out then log back in and authenticate without resetting cookies
  • Terminal should show a Multi-Factor Authentication event with the property "new_device" : false

@kevinsmaster5 kevinsmaster5 force-pushed the kmas-lg-11763-new-device-mfa-analytics branch from 82f0aa2 to b4dc743 Compare December 19, 2023 15:39
@kevinsmaster5 kevinsmaster5 marked this pull request as ready for review December 20, 2023 19:28
Copy link
Contributor

@aduth aduth left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I left a few minor comments, but this looks good, and works in my testing! 👍

Copy link
Contributor

@aduth aduth left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M 👍

@kevinsmaster5 kevinsmaster5 merged commit c6bb216 into main Jan 5, 2024
@kevinsmaster5 kevinsmaster5 deleted the kmas-lg-11763-new-device-mfa-analytics branch January 5, 2024 13:41
@amirbey amirbey mentioned this pull request Jan 9,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ants